Generative Models for Stochastic Processes Using Convolutional Neural Networks

9 Jan 2018  ·  Fernando Fernandes Neto ·

The present paper aims to demonstrate the usage of Convolutional Neural Networks as a generative model for stochastic processes, enabling researchers from a wide range of fields (such as quantitative finance and physics) to develop a general tool for forecasts and simulations without the need to identify/assume a specific system structure or estimate its parameters.
